Default Re: Headlight replacing

An '89 Civic with sealed beam headlights? Don't believe it. My '87 used
9004 bulbs, www.sylvania.com says the '89 used 9005 for high beams and
9006 for low beams. Looking at www.hondaautomotiveparts.com you can see
that there are two regular bulbs in each headlight assembly.
